Abstract

With the updating of science and technology, the development of modern agricultural technology in China is also progressing. The research of intelligent greenhouse control system has far-reaching significance. Greenhouse control system should meet the function demands of data acquisition, data transmission and remote monitoring. In this paper, the overall control structure of greenhouse is formulated within the framework of Internet of Things technology, which is divided into perception layer, transmission layer and application layer. Based on the architecture of Internet of Things and Zig Bee wireless sensor network technology, this paper designs four modules of the control system, including login management module, data display module, remote control module and system management module. The greenhouse control system of the Internet of Things is tested and analysed and the experimental results show that the system can achieve the expected effect of greenhouse.
